About Harmony Public Schools
Harmony Public Schools is a network of PK-12 college preparatory public charter schools across Texas. For almost two decades, our schools have provided students from under-served communities the opportunity to excel in their studies in a small classroom environment focused on providing the skills they need to succeed in life. The Texas-based non-profit organization was established by a group of dedicated educators and university academicians who were passionate about the way children approached math and science. Since 2000 HPS has grown to 56 campuses, 35,000+ students, with a 98 percent graduation rate for seniors and 100 percent college acceptance rate. Our mission is to prepare each student for higher education by providing a safe, caring, and collaborative atmosphere featuring a quality, student-centered educational program with a strong emphasis on science, technology, engineering, and math (STEM).
